运行git init是两次初始化存储库还是重新初始化现有的回购?

内容来源于 Stack Overflow,并遵循CC BY-SA 3.0许可协议进行翻译与使用

  • 回答 (2)
  • 关注 (0)
  • 查看 (88)

当你发出git init再次?

我创建了一个存储库git init...。创建了一个文件,添加,提交。检查状态(没有要提交的内容)。然后创建另一个文件,检查状态,我可以看到它是未跟踪的,正如预期的那样。

然后,说错了,我又一次运行git init,我得到了重新初始化现有的Git存储库消息

试过git status,但它显示的是同样的。那么到底会发生什么呢?

提问于
用户回答回答于

官方文档:

在现有存储库中运行git init是安全的。它不会覆盖已经存在的东西。重新运行git init的主要原因是获取新添加的模板。

用户回答回答于

这在git init文件:

跑动Git在现有的存储库中是安全的。它不会覆盖已经存在的东西。重新运行的主要原因吉特是获取新添加的模板。

扫码关注云+社区